About this episode
In today’s episode, Martin chats with Gregoire Toussaint who is a Director in the EDC Paris office and leads the B2B payments practice.In our conversation, we talk about insights from recent research carried out by EDC into B2B payments including regional differences, key pain points, and emerging best practices.

Guest Bio

Grégoire is a Director in the Paris office with over 15 years of consulting experience with EDC in business strategy for clients in Asia, Europe, North and South America. Grégoire has worked in EDC's London, Sydney and Paris offices and developed global perspectives on payments. Within EDC, Greg leads EDC’s B2B Payments Practice and has developed specific expertise in retail and travel payments, working for all actors in the payments value chain (e.g. central banks, issuers, acquirers, payment schemes, merchants and payment providers).
